3 Tips to help you be less hungry:



1) Eat 5 walnuts or 8 almonds before a meal (roughly 65 cal) to stimulate production of cholecystokinin, a hormone that slows your stomach from emptying so you feel fuller much longer.



2) Brush your teeth frequently – at least 3-4 times a day. Not only will this give you a great smile and keep your breath fresh, but you’re much less likely to want a snack after brushing your teeth.



3) Limit yourself to 3 bites of anything you crave then wait 15 minutes before taking another bite. This will give your body a chance to register the satiety & curb your cravings!

1. I could definitely see that. Not sure about the hormone thing, but if you eat slower, you tend to eat less as you feel full sooner. So eating a little something before a meal could definitely help that.



2. Definitely agree with the theory, but my wife (a dental hygienist) and most dentists suggest not brushing more than 3x a day; 2x is usually plenty as is. excessive brushing agitates your gums a lot leading to possible recession, which isn't a good thing.



3. Also very much agree... but once you pop, you can't stop.
